The Conditional Influences of Organizational Climate on the Relationship between the Number and Types of Implementation Strategies and Lupus Decision Aid Acceptability, Appropriateness, and Feasibility

2023-12-19

Abstract excerpt

<title>Abstract</title> <p><bold>Background:</bold> Empirical research is inconsistent regarding the relationship between the number of implementation strategies and the implementation of evidence-based interventions. One potential explanation for inconsistent relationships is an assumption that different types of strategies will have a similar impact on different implementation outcomes.
